自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(44)
  • 收藏
  • 关注

转载 关于如果解决 iOS 虚拟键盘弹出 fixed 定位错乱的方法

其实网上有很多所谓的解决方案,但真正能解决的没几个,都是复制黏贴的文章,说真的,真没啥意思。关于如何如果去解决 iOS 虚拟键盘弹出 fixed 定位错乱的问题?回归源头,那就是不要用 fixed 定位,当然,我是指带 input 和 textarea 需要呼出虚拟键盘的页面,并不是全盘否定大全局禁用 fixed 定位。页面常见布局分别为 header、main、footer...

2017-08-10 11:10:00 805

转载 关于 Vue2.0 路由开启 keep-alive 时需要注意的地方

Vue2.0 做应用必有的需求就是页面数据需要做缓存,不用每次进入页面都要把数据重新请求一遍,每次页面切换都有段等待数据相应时间,这个用户体验可想有多么蛋疼,所以页面缓存是必要的,啥时候需要更新页面数据呢?可以监听状态变化,或者是手动下拉刷新重新请求数据,酱紫,我想用户体验会做的更好。废话不多说直接上码,一般是在 src/App.vue 设置开启 keep-alive 实现页面数据缓...

2017-08-09 10:32:00 126

转载 关于 Vue2.0-Spa 单页应用如何实现历史位置记录问题

网上搜索比较多的解决方案就是,类似 vue-router 开启 HTML5 的 history 模式,Nginx 配置解决这个历史位置记录问题,因为个人觉得很麻烦,所以没采用。相关文章我在这里提供下,有兴趣可以去了解:https://segmentfault.com/q/1010000006177894/a-1020000006619306https://route...

2017-08-08 11:56:00 249

转载 Vue2.0 + VueRouter2.0 + webpack + Vue-cli => 开发环境搭建

使用 Vue2.0-cli 脚手架(属于Vue全家桶)快速构建项目【1】首先需要先安装好node.js;【2】安装webpack输入指令 $ npm install -g webpack【3】安装 $ npm install -g vue-cli   //全局安装Vue-cli【4】$ Vue init webpack projectName   //生成项...

2017-08-07 15:09:00 94

转载 关于 wamp apache 的虚拟机配置多域名访问的解决方法

1. 修改 Hosts 文件C:\WINDOWS\system32\drivers\etc\Hosts127.0.0.1 www.a.com127.0.0.1 www.b.com127.0.0.1 www.c.com2. 编辑 wamp\bin\apache\apache2.4.9\conf\extra\httpd-vhosts.conf 文件,在文件底部加入...

2016-07-15 09:56:00 93

转载 关于 svn 提交后文件的用户名和组群为 root 权限的解决方法

阿里云服务器环境(PHP+Nginx+MySQL)我们一般很少用 root 来创建项目,一般都会自己创建一个新用户,如果一直喜欢使用 root 权限来创建项目的人可以直接绕道啦。我们 svn 版本管理系统虽然搭建好了,但是本地提交文件后,使用 ls -la 指令查看,发现用户名和组群都是 root,该怎么办呢?【方法1】在post-commit 文件的末尾加上一段代码:...

2016-07-11 18:03:00 313

转载 关于 MySQL 允许 root 远程登录的解决方法

阿里云服务器环境(PHP+Nginx+MySQL)【吐槽】我勒个去,照着网上的方法一样一样的敲,结果把我带进坑了,郁闷了整个上午,现把我踩的坑和解决方法呈现如下:【网上带我跳坑的方法】(一定不要这么做)mysql> use mysql;mysql> update user set host='%' where user='root' AND host='l...

2016-07-10 14:21:00 95

转载 关于“post-commit hook failed (exit code 255) with no output.”的解决方法

阿里云服务器环境(PHP+Nginx+MySQL)1. 首先给post-commit 设置权限(hooks目录下):chmod 755 post-commit2. 清空 post-commit 里面的代码,然后敲入以下代码并保存:#!/bin/shexport LANG=en_US.UTF-8/usr/bin/svn up /data/wwwroo...

2016-07-10 03:22:00 374

转载 关于“Warning: RPMDB altered outside of yum”的解决办法

【错误提示】Warning: RPMDB altered outside of yum【解决办法】删除 yum 的历史记录rm -rf /var/lib/yum/history/*.sqlite 上面的命令可能需要 root 权限才能执行done!转载于:https://www.cnblogs.com/viphchok/articles/5655929.html...

2016-07-09 15:11:00 657

转载 关于 SQLyog 远程连接 Linux 系统的 MySQL 失败的解决方法

阿里云服务器环境(PHP+Nginx+MySQL)【吐槽】我勒个去,照着网上的方法一样一样的敲,结果把我带进坑了,郁闷了整个上午,现把我的解决方法呈现如下:关于“Access denied for user 'root'@'*.*.*.*'(using password: YES)”的解决方法MySQL安装完成后,默认是不允许 root 进行远程登录的,我们需要修改...

2016-07-09 15:06:00 234

转载 关于 wordpress 完美整站迁移(Linux环境)的教程

阿里云服务器环境(PHP+Nginx+MySQL)【方法】1. 打开终端(Xshell / SecureCRT / 其他)2. 进入你的网站根目录(将你网站程序进行打包):zip -r -p [网站目录名].zip [网站目录]3. 将压缩包下载到本地:sz [网站目录名].zip4. 用 phpMyAdmin / SQLyog 导出你的数据库(my...

2016-07-09 14:27:00 794

转载 关于 Linux 如何修改服务器用户密码

【方法】打开终端(Xshell / SecureCRT / 其他)1. 当前为普通用户:输入 passwd 指令,先输入自己的旧密码,再输入两遍新密码;2. 当前为root用户:输入 password [username],修改 [username] 的密码,输入两遍新密码,不用输入旧密码;3. 当前为root用户:输入 passwd 直接修改 root 密码,阿里云在购买服务器的时候,...

2016-07-09 13:48:00 907

转载 关于 Linux 如何查看自己的 UID 和 GID

【扫盲】GID 为 GroupId,即 组ID,用来标识用户组的唯一标识符UID 为 UserId,即 用户ID,用来标识每个用户的唯一标示符【扩展】用户组:将同一类用户设置为同一个组,如可将所有的系统管理员设置为 admin 组,便于分配权限,将某些重要的文件设置为所有 admin 组用户可以读写,这样可以进行权限分配。每个用户都有一个唯一的用户 id,每个用户组都有一个唯一的组 ...

2016-07-09 13:03:00 684

转载 关于“svn: Can't connect to host '*.*.*.*': 由于连接方在一段时间后没有正确答复或连接”的解决方法...

阿里云服务器环境(PHP+Nginx+MySQL)【原因1】svnserve.conf 没写好,当然你先备份一份先:cp svnserve.conf svnserve.conf.bak打开此文件vi svnserve.conf 清空里面的所有代码,复制黏贴以下代码:[general]anon-access = readauth-acce...

2016-07-09 12:33:00 597

转载 关于 Linux 系统(centos)完美搭建 svn 版本管理系统的教程

阿里云服务器环境(PHP+Nginx+MySQL)我在百度翻了个遍,按照前辈们的方法一样一样的敲,在客户端总是打不开,我特么的郁闷了一晚上。如:"svn: Can't connect to host '*.*.*.*': 由于连接方在一段时间后没有正确答复或连接"......(这里省略数亿个“草泥马”的复制&黏贴)【废话不多说,将我总结的集完美与帅气于一身的方法分...

2016-07-08 01:07:00 136

转载 关于 JavaScript 本地对象、内置对象、宿主对象

1. 本地对象/原生对象(Native object)定义:独立于宿主环境的 ECMAScript 实现提供的对象。包括如下:Object、Function、Array、String、Boolean、Number、Date、RegExp、Error、EvalError、RangeError、ReferenceError、SyntaxError、TypeError、URIErr...

2016-07-06 11:52:00 95

转载 JavaScript遁·判断 IE 浏览器之术

  用了许久的jQuery/zepto.js ,随着工龄的增长,不利于我们探索原生的奥秘,JavaScript 作为我们前端开发工程师的母语,如果我们连母语都不深刻了解,熟练运用,那就会被众人耻笑,所以,我决定减少对这些封装库的使用,回归原生,再或者我特么自己用原生封装自己的一个库,对,就是要这么的牛逼!  我们知道 IE 的引擎和标准浏览器的引擎之间总是有些许差异,因为 IE 这...

2016-07-04 10:35:00 73

转载 关于如何预览 github 项目里的网页或 Demo?

【方法1】http://htmlpreview.github.io/【方法2】http://htmlpreview.github.com/?[github的文件路径]done!转载于:https://www.cnblogs.com/viphchok/articles/5655976.html

2016-06-09 15:29:00 153

转载 关于阿里云服务器安装 wordpress(linux环境)的教程

阿里云服务器环境(PHP+Nginx+MySQL)1. 打开终端(Xshell / SecureCRT / 其他),我用的是securecrt ;2. 如果不是 root 用户,先用 su 命令切换到 root 用户:su root3. 创建一个 mysql 用户,可以使用 CREATE USER:先使用 mysql 的 root 用户登录进入mysql模式:...

2016-05-20 18:32:00 375

转载 关于如何去掉底部的织梦版权信息 powered by dedecms 的解决方法

在 include/dedesql.classs.php 文件中找到第 588 行:$arrs1 = array(0x63,0x66,0x67,0x5f,0x70,0x6f,0x77,0x65,0x72,0x62,0x79); $arrs2 = array(0x20,0x3c,0x61,0x20,0x68,0x72,0x65,0x66,0x3d,0x68,0x74,0x74,...

2016-05-15 14:17:00 248

转载 本人两年移动端开发中踩的坑和一些经验总结(持续更新...)

本人接触移动端Web开发两年有余,说起移动端开发大多数是基于微信平台下开发的产品,这里先写下一些我所碰到的坑和经验总结,方便以后开发遗忘查阅。BLOG LINK(更新于20160510)关于微信H5页面开发中音乐不自动播放的解决方法关于微信H5网页开发中二维码无法识别的解决方法关于 JavaScript & jQuery 操作 <audio> 标签...

2016-05-10 11:33:00 217

转载 关于 JavaScript 如何去掉字符串中标签的方法

这里我们可以用到 JavaScript 中的replace() 方法,简单配合一个正则表达式即可完成,来,师兄给你封装一个方法拿走不谢:var fnCleanStrTags = function(str) { var s = str.replace(/<.*?>/ig,""); return s;}调用var ss = fnC...

2016-05-01 15:13:00 153

转载 【F2E】viewport 模板(通用 HTML5 初始 *.html 文件)

<!DOCTYPE html><html><head> <meta charset="utf-8"> <meta content="width=device-width,initial-scale=1.0,maximum-scale=1.0,user-scalable=no" name="viewpor...

2016-04-22 10:35:00 86

转载 关于 dedecms 网站程序及数据库完美迁移的教程

1. 首先登录织梦的后台,进入到“系统>数据库备份/还原”栏目;2. 如果之前有备份过数据,就需要将织梦程序根目录下的 data 文件夹下的 backupdata 文件夹改名为其他名称,如”_backupdata”;3. 全选所有的表,根据情况选择 MySQL 版本,按照默认选项提交备份;4. 备份成功后,将网站所有程序和目录上传到新的服务器。然后将...

2016-04-15 17:45:00 187

转载 关于 JavaScript & jQuery 操作 <audio> 标签

<audio src="music.mp3">您的浏览器不支持 audio 标签。</audio>JavaScript 实例代码var oAudio = document.getElementById("audio");oAudio.play(); //播放oAdio.pause(); //暂停jQuery 实例代码...

2016-04-15 11:35:00 166

转载 关于 PNG8/PNG24/PNG32 之间的区别

  我想,作为前端对于这个算是很熟悉了吧?是不是切图的时候经常要【存为Web所用格式】这个导出透明图片吧?  我们都知道要这么做,这个习以为常的东西,你知道他们的区别吗?我们常用 PNG8/PNG24 或许我们可以说个大概,但 PNG32 是什么鬼?嗯,是不是感觉问这个很无聊吧?但是,我们平时不注意的东西,往往就出现在面试题当中,相信大家一看到这些题目第一感觉就是 W!T!F! 这是...

2016-04-15 11:10:00 221

转载 关于 JavaScript & jQuery 的插件开发

  最近在温故 JavaScript 的面向对象,于是乎再次翻开了《JavaScript高级程序设计》第3版,了解到其中常见的设计模式,以前刚出道时遗留下来的困惑和不解,同时也茅塞顿开豁然开朗了,每一次翻阅每一次都有新的认识。  之前写过 jQuery 插件,其实其中原理也很简单,不过我在想原生 JavaScript 插件的我应该要怎么写?网上的教程略显复杂,我自己理解来说就是把一些...

2016-04-12 11:01:00 76

转载 解决 PC 端中网页文本一键复制的小插件

废话不多说,直接上码,注释写的很清楚了:<!DOCTYPE HTML><html><head><meta charset="utf-8"><title>jQuery.zclip Test</title><style type="text/css">.line{margin-...

2016-04-01 12:10:00 777

转载 【F2E】关于 Web 开发中图片格式选择过程

转载于:https://www.cnblogs.com/viphchok/articles/5344430.html

2016-04-01 11:46:00 64

转载 如何让恶心的低版本 IE 系列浏览器支持 HTML5 标签

下面是引用 Google 的 html5.js 文件(嗯,在天朝,我们并不用这个,你懂的):<!---[if lt IE 9]>  <script src=”http://html5shiv.googlecode.com/svn/trunk/html5.js”></script>< ![endif]-->下面是引用 ...

2016-04-01 11:32:00 67

转载 【F2E】移动端(webapp)开发性能优化方案

转载于:https://www.cnblogs.com/viphchok/articles/5344225.html

2016-04-01 11:07:00 120

转载 【F2E】浏览器样式重置(reset.css)

@charset "utf-8";/**! * $Project => #CSSRESET# * $Date => 2016/04/01 Friday * $Author => CHOK师兄 || F2E * $E-Mail => viphchok@qq.com * $Copyright => ...

2016-04-01 10:50:00 124

转载 jQuery 追加元素的方法如 append、prepend、before

1. jQuery append() 方法jQuery append() 方法在被选元素的结尾插入内容: $("p").append("Some appended text."); 2. jQuery prepend() 方法jQuery prepend() 方法在被选元素的开头插入内容: $("p").prepend("Some prepended te...

2016-03-29 11:03:00 121

转载 【F2E】前端开发工程师的学习路径参考

若想成为一名在任何企业都受(抢)欢(着)迎(要)的前端开发工程师,你根本没有时间去偷懒,快看看你自己会多少?图片的字体看不清?可以【右键】-【复制图像地址】-【黏贴到浏览器打开】-【OK】-【快去学习吧】转载于:https://www.cnblogs.com/viphchok/articles/5331856.html...

2016-03-29 09:56:00 53

转载 【转】gulp 安装及配合组件构建前端开发一体化

所有功能前提需要安装 nodejs 和 ruby 。Gulp 是一款基于任务的设计模式的自动化工具,通过插件的配合解决全套前端解决方案,如静态页面压缩、图片压缩、JS合并、SASS同步编译并压缩CSS、服务器控制客户端同步刷新。一、Gulp安装全局安装Gulpjsnpm install -g gulp #全局安装局部安装Gulpjsnpm insta...

2016-03-28 10:43:00 94

转载 【F2E】前端开发规范(JavaScript)

四、JavaScript1. 缩进使用soft tab(4个空格)。var x = 1, y = 1;if (x < y) { x += 10;} else { x += 1;}2. 单行长度不要超过80,但如果编辑器开启word wrap可以不考虑单行长度。3. 分号以下几种情况后需加分号:变量声明...

2016-03-27 23:49:00 99

转载 【F2E】前端开发规范(CSS & SCSS)

三、CSS, SCSS1. 缩进使用 soft tab(4个空格).element { position: absolute; top: 10px; left: 10px; border-radius: 10px; width: 50px; height: 50px;}2. 分号每个属性声明末尾都...

2016-03-27 23:20:00 88

转载 【F2E】前端开发规范(命名规则 & HTML)

一、命名规则1. 项目命名全部采用小写方式, 以下划线分隔。例:my_project_name2. JS文件命名参照项目命名规则。例:account_model.js3. CSS, SCSS文件命名参照项目命名规则。例:retina_sprites.scss4. HTML文件命名参照项目命名规则。例:error_report.html二、HTML1. 语法...

2016-03-27 22:31:00 152

转载 Git 常用指令&使用方法

1. 创建本地仓库(repository),将会在文件夹下创建一个 .git 文件夹,.git 文件夹里存储了所有的版本信息、标记等内容:git init here 2. 把本地仓库和远程仓库关联起来。如果不执行这个命令的话,每次 push 的时候都需要指定远程服务器的地址:git remote add origin git@github.com:xxx/tex...

2016-03-25 11:27:00 46

转载 【转】JS判断客户端是否为PC还是手持设备

function IsPC(){ var userAgentInfo = navigator.userAgent; var Agents = new Array("Android", "iPhone", "SymbianOS", "Windows Phone", "iPad", "iPod"); var flag = true; ...

2016-03-25 11:16:00 65

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除